How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Clark County?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Clark County Studio Apartments | $1,634 | $1,007 | $4,100 |
| Clark County 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,755 | $1,069 | $4,720 |
| Clark County 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,999 | $1,200 | $6,375 |
| Clark County 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,401 | $1,535 | $3,525 |
| Clark County 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,243 | $2,056 | $2,860 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Clark County Apartments with Washer/Dryer
What is the Cheapest Washer/Dryer apartment in Clark County?
Currently the most affordable Apartment in Clark County with Washer/Dryer is at Fairview Court Townhomes listed at $1,165.
How much is the average rent for Clark County Apartments with Washer/Dryer?
The average rent for a Apartment in Clark County with Washer/Dryer is $1,947.
What is the largest Clark County Apartment for rent with Washer/Dryer?
Today's Apartment with Washer/Dryer and the most square footage in Clark County is a 3,030 square feet unit starting from $1,220 at The Felix @ Our Heroes Place.
What is the average size for Clark County Apartments for rent with Washer/Dryer?
The average size for a rental with Washer/Dryer in Clark County is currently at 726 sq ft.
